Abstract
Techniques to determine a position estimate for a wireless terminal. An accurate position estimate for the initially obtained (e.g., based on a first (accurate) position determination sub-system). For each of one or more transmitters (e.g., base stations) in a second (less accurate) position determination sub-system, an “expected” pseudo-range is computed based on the accurate position estimate for the terminal and the base station location, a “measured” pseudo-range is also obtained, and a pseudo-range residual is then determined based on the expected pseudo-range and the measured pseudo-range. Therefore, to determine an updated position estimate for the terminal, measured pseudo-ranges are obtained for a sufficient number of transmitters. The measured pseudo-range for each base station may be corrected based on the associated residual. The updated position estimate is then determined based on the corrected pseudo-ranges for these transmitters.

20. A method for determining a position estimate for a wireless terminal, comprising:
-
determining an accurate position estimate for the terminal based on measured pseudo-ranges to a plurality of satellites in a Global Positioning System (GPS);
computing an expected pseudo-range to each of one or more base stations in a cellular communication system based on the accurate position estimate for the terminal and a location for the base station;
obtaining a measured pseudo-range to each of the one or more base stations;
determining a pseudo-range residual for each of the one or more base stations based on the expected pseudo-range and the measured pseudo-range for the base station;
obtaining a measured pseudo-range for each of a plurality of transmitters, wherein each of the plurality of transmitters is either a GPS satellite or a base station;
correcting the measured pseudo-range for each base station in the plurality of transmitters based on the pseudo-range residual determined for the base station; and
determining an updated position estimate for the terminal based on a plurality of pseudo-ranges for the plurality of transmitters, wherein the plurality of pseudo-ranges include at least one corrected pseudo-range for at least one base station.

21. A method for determining a position estimate for a wireless terminal based on first and second position determination sub-systems, wherein a position estimate based on the first sub-system is typically more accurate than a position estimate based on the second sub-system, the method comprising:
-
determining the position estimate for the terminal based on the first sub-system if the first sub-system is available;
determining the position estimate for the terminal based on the first and second sub-systems if the first sub-system is partially available, wherein a measurement for each transmitter in the second sub-system used to determine the position estimate is corrected based on a residual, if available, for the transmitter; and
determining the position estimate for the terminal based solely on the second sub-system if the first sub-system is unavailable, wherein the measurement for each of at least one transmitter in the second sub-system used to determine the position estimate is corrected based on the residual for the transmitter. - View Dependent Claims (22, 23, 24, 25, 26, 27, 28, 29, 30, 31)
